Highly recommended to reserve as they get packed rather quickly. Lovely outdoor seating with the most amazing view. Their food is great quality and flavour! Going out to pick some roses or simply walking the field after food is just the topping on the cake for this hidden gem of a place.Cost for a full breakfast (including beverage) for one: R150 max.Picking Roses: R8 per rose. Make sure to have an ID or Drivers or pay R100 fee for the 'hire' of your bucket and clippers (you get them back afterwards).
